01 - Preheat grill to medium-high heat (or oven to 430°F if roasting).
02 - In a small bowl, whisk together melted butter, sm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, thyme, oregano, cayenne, black pepper, and salt until smooth.
03 - Brush each ear of corn generously with the Cajun spice mixture, ensuring all sides are evenly coated.
04 - Arrange corn directly on grill grates (or on parchment-lined baking sheet if roasting).
05 - Cook corn, turning every 3–4 minutes, until nicely charred and tender, about 12–15 minutes total.
06 - Remove from heat and let cool slightly. Garnish with fresh parsley if desired and serve with lemon wedges for squeezing.
